Menu

Tree [6d74f4] main v1.4.5 /
 History

HTTPS access


File Date Author Commit
 Infoscava-linux.cpp 2025-07-09 Muhammed Shafin P Muhammed Shafin P [22f9c3] Add files via upload
 Infoscava.cpp 2025-07-08 Muhammed Shafin P Muhammed Shafin P [d9fe9f] Add files via upload
 LICENSE.txt 2025-07-08 Muhammed Shafin P Muhammed Shafin P [d9fe9f] Add files via upload
 README.md 2025-07-09 Muhammed Shafin P Muhammed Shafin P [6d74f4] Add files via upload
 a.iss 2025-07-09 Muhammed Shafin P Muhammed Shafin P [7f5503] Add files via upload
 icon.ico 2025-07-08 Muhammed Shafin P Muhammed Shafin P [d9fe9f] Add files via upload
 icon.jpg 2025-07-08 Muhammed Shafin P Muhammed Shafin P [d9fe9f] Add files via upload
 icon.rc 2025-07-08 Muhammed Shafin P Muhammed Shafin P [d9fe9f] Add files via upload
 icon.res 2025-07-08 Muhammed Shafin P Muhammed Shafin P [d9fe9f] Add files via upload
 main.py 2025-07-09 Muhammed Shafin P Muhammed Shafin P [7f5503] Add files via upload
 u.ico 2025-07-08 Muhammed Shafin P Muhammed Shafin P [d9fe9f] Add files via upload

Read Me

Infoscava - Universal File Analyzer

Infoscava is a desktop application for comprehensive file analysis.

Infoscava Icon

Download:v1.4.5

Key Features in v1.4.5

  • File Analysis: Metadata, hashes, text, hex, structured data (JSON), image (EXIF, GPS), Base64, entropy, byte histograms.
  • User Interface: Tabbed design, file browser, drag-and-drop, theme toggle, file watcher, keyboard shortcuts, analysis export.
  • Standalone Windows Executable (.exe): No Python environment needed.
  • Embedded Icon: Custom application icon (icon.ico included in the repository).
  • Standard Installer: User-friendly installation.
  • Right-Click Context Menu: "Open with Infoscava" integration.
  • Security Enhancements: Basic security checks to prevent loading files from sensitive system directories.

User Interface:

  • Tabbed design for organized analysis views.
  • Integrated file browser and drag-and-drop support for easy file loading.
  • Theme Toggle: Switch between Dark and Light themes.
  • File Watcher: Automatic reload of the file if changes are detected on disk.
  • Keyboard shortcuts for common actions.
  • Analysis Export: Export comprehensive analysis reports to JSON, TXT, or HTML formats.

Plugin System:

  • Dynamic Plugin Loading: Support for custom analysis and reporting plugins defined by .infoscava files (containing Base64-encoded Python code).
  • Plugin Management: Dialog for loading new plugins, reloading existing ones, and deleting plugins.
  • Dynamic Plugin Tabs: Plugins can generate their own tabs for custom output, including HTML reports, JSON tables, or plain text.
  • Plugin History: A dedicated tab to log plugin loading, execution, and deletion events.

Contribution & Support

We are actively looking for contributors, collaborators, and supporters to help grow Infoscava!

  • Problems/Bugs: If you encounter any issues, please use the Discussions section or create a new Issue.
  • Contributions: We welcome code contributions, feature suggestions, and any form of support. Feel free to reach out via discussions or pull requests.

We plan to create a Linux version and continue with more updates and bug fixes. Please support and contribute to the community.

Credits

Developer: Muhammed Shafin P (@hejhdiss)

Built with PySide6, PyInstaller, and Inno Setup.

License

This project is licensed under the MIT License.